Abstract

The goal of this study is to look into the toxic parenting pattern used by a single parent named Akiko towards her child, Shuhei. This study will look at several types of toxic parenting as well as the psychological state of a child who has been subjected to toxic parenting treatment. This study employs a qualitative descriptive approach with informal methodologies. This study employs Hurlock's family role theory and Minderop's literary psychological theory. According to the findings of this research, Akiko plays a significant role in the family as a mother, which places Shuhei under Akiko's authority and influence. Akiko's poisonous parenting style is one that approaches dictatorial behaviour. Shuhei is put off by Akiko's authoritarian actions, which appear overly strict or overprotective. The effects of these treatments had an effect on Shuhei's psychological state.

Abstract

This research discusses the deixis that appeared in President Barack Obama's farewell speech on NBC News on January 10, 2017 in Chicago. The Farewell Address focused on key themes such as democracy, unity, and the importance of civic engagement. The speech reflects his enduring belief in the fundamental values that define the United States and his hope for a better future for all Americans. To achieve the purpose of Obama's speech, the researcher used a deixis approach. The method used in this study is a qualitative descriptive method by recording all the data that appears in President Barack Obama’s Farewell Address in NBC News. Deixis can be used to influence audiences or readers in a variety of ways, including in order to establish identity, build emotional connections, or influence views and attitudes. The results of the study show that Obama often uses the word "we" because Obama wants his audience to receive information and influence Americans with his words. The most dominant spatial data that appears is America.

Abstract

This study aims to analyze the implementation of educational games in Islamic Education (PAI) learning in the digital era to improve students' understanding at SMPN 1 Krian. The use of educational games such as Kahoot! and Quizizz was chosen to create an interactive and enjoyable learning experience, focusing on increasing student engagement and strengthening understanding of PAI concepts such as fiqh, aqidah, and morality. This research uses a qualitative-descriptive approach, where data were collected through observations, interviews with teachers and students. The results show that the use of educational games in PAI learning successfully increased students' learning motivation, deepened their understanding of the material taught, and created a more dynamic learning atmosphere. Instant feedback provided through educational game platforms helped students quickly correct their mistakes and enhanced active participation in class. Thus, the implementation of educational games has proven effective in supporting PAI learning at SMPN 1 Krian and is relevant to technological developments in the digital era.

Abstract

The development of digital technology has encouraged the world of education to adapt to various learning innovations, including in Islamic Education (PAI) subjects. One of the improvement efforts made by teachers is the use of interactive educational games that are able to present religious material in an interesting and contextual way. This study aims to describe the implementation of digitalization of PAI learning through interactive educational game media. This study uses a descriptive qualitative approach with data collection techniques through observation, interviews, and documentation. The data analysis technique uses a tematic model. The results of the study show that the use of interactive educational games can increase student learning motivation, facilitate understanding of religious material, and create a dynamic, communicative and collaborative learning environment. Instant feedback provided through the educational game platform helps students correct their mistakes quickly and increases active participation in class. The integration of interactive game-based learning models in PAI lessons is unique amidst the rampant conventional methods used by teachers. This proves that digital media is not only relevant for general subjects, but is also effective in transforming religious teaching methods to be more contextual and preferred by digital generation students.

Abstract

All agricultural tools require key components in the manufacturing process, one of which is metal. The metal commonly used in the manufacture of agricultural machinery is a type of steel with a medium carbon content. This type of metal is found in many vehicle parts, so parts with moderate carbon content are spring parts. Therefore, this study was conducted to determine the effect of temperature variations on the manufacture of agricultural equipment products made from coil springs on their mechanical properties. In this study, an analysis of the coil spring steel was carried out. The research methods used included sample pieces, heat treatment with temperature changes of 815 OC, 830 OC and 850 OC, quenching with SAE 20-50 W oil cooling media, hardness test and metallographic test. From the results of the study, the highest percentage of martensite microstructure was at 850 OC temperature specimens with a value of 64% and the lowest percentage was at 830 OC temperature specimens with a value of 42%. The high percentage of bainite microstructure is at 830 OC temperature specimen with a value of 58% and the lowest percentage is at 850 OC temperature specimen with a value of 36%. Meanwhile, the highest percentage of ferrite microstructure is at 815 OC temperature specimens and the lowest percentage is in non heat treated specimens with a value of 40%. By comparison on non-heat treated specimens which have a value of 40% ferrite and 60% pearlite. The microstructure with the largest grain shape is found in the specimen at 850 OC temperature with grain number 4 and the micro structure with the smallest grain shape is found in the specimen at 815 OC having grain number 6 with a comparison of non-heat treated specimens having grain number 7. Obtained an average value – The highest average hardness with oil cooling media on coil spring steel has a hardness value of 76.75 HRC at a temperature of 850°C. While the lowest average hardness value with oil cooling media on coil spring steel has a hardness value of 75.4 HRC, namely at a temperature of 815 °C, with a hardness ratio of 71.3 HRC in the initial conditions without heat treatment.
